Program Information
- All courses must be passed with a “C-” (1.7) or better to be counted in the certificate.
- Students must earn a minimum overall GPA of 2.0 to be awarded the certificate.
- This program requires the completion of MATH 1210 - Calculus I . Students who are not prepared for this math course may need additional math credits/preparation, which may affect time to graduation. Please consult your Student Success Advisor for more information.
Certificate Completion
This certificate program may be completed independently and does not require enrollment in or completion of any degree program to be awarded.

Program Learning Outcomes
- Proficiency in AI and ML Applications in Engineering: Upon completion of the program, students will demonstrate a proficient understanding of artificial intelligence and machine learning concepts, methodologies, and tools, enabling them to apply these skills effectively in engineering contexts such as machine learning algorithms, computer vision techniques, and predictive maintenance utilizing AI technologies.
- Problem-Solving and Critical Thinking: Graduates will exhibit advanced problem-solving abilities and critical thinking skills within the realm of AI and ML in engineering. They will be capable of analyzing complex engineering challenges, formulating innovative AI-based solutions, and evaluating the efficacy of these solutions in real-world scenarios.
- Collaboration and Interdisciplinary Competence: Students completing the program will showcase competence in interdisciplinary collaboration, being able to communicate and work effectively with professionals from diverse fields. This outcome will empower graduates to contribute meaningfully to multidisciplinary teams, driving innovation in engineering projects that incorporate AI and ML applications.
